What's The Definition Of Vinegar fly?
[n] flies whose larvae feed on pickles and imperfectly sealed preserves
Synonyms | Synonyms for Vinegar fly: Related Terms | Find terms related to Vinegar fly: See Also | fruit fly | genus Drosophila | pomace fly Vinegar fly In Webster's Dictionary \Vin"e*gar fly\
Any of several fruit flies, esp. {Drosophila ampelopophila},
which breed in imperfectly sealed preserves and in pickles.
